Siddaramaiah resigns from K'taka Assembly membership

Bangalore, July 18 (UNI) Former Karnataka Deputy Chief Minister Siddaramaiah, suspended from the Janata Dal (Secular) for indulging in ''anti-party activities'', today resigned his membership of the State Assembly.

Mr Siddaramaiah, who was tipped to join the Congress later this month, tendered his resignation letter to Speaker Krishna, who accepted it.
